Calls for Papers On 2 June 2014 abstracts are due for an international conference entitled Material Koinai in the Greek Early Iron Age and Archaic Period, to be held on 30 January 1 February 2015 at the Danish Institute at Athens. Abstracts (400 words maximum, to include name, affiliation, and contact information) should be submitted to [email protected]. Further information is available at http://www.diathens.gr/en/events/konferencer. On 15 June 2014 abstracts are due for the Cultures of Stone 2014 Conference, to be held at University College Dublin (UCD) on 1820 September 2014, jointly organized by UCD School of Archaeology and UCD School of Classics with the support of the National Museum of Ireland. Abstracts (300 words, to include the title of the presentation, authors and institutional affiliation, and the most appropriate conference theme(s)) should be submitted to [email protected]. Further information is available at http://culturesofstone.eu.pn/. Presentations from any period and geographical context are invited around the following themes: The moving, trade, and exchange of stone Sensory perception and engagement with stone The reinterpretation of stone through experimental approaches The ritualistic and symbolic meaning of stone The transformation of stone from its sourcing to its final deposition Stone and monumentality On 11 September 2014 abstracts (200 words) are due for the 80 th Annual Meeting of the Society for American Archaeology (SAA 2015), to be held from 1519 April 2015 in San Francisco, CA. Further information is available at http://www.saa.org/. Turkey   2014)   meeting,   to   be   held   on   27-­‐28   November   2014   at  Mimar   Sinan   University  (İstanbul).   Papers   are   invited   that   are   aimed   at   exploring   the   ways   of   defining   the  interaction  of  things  and  their  interrelation  with  other  things  and  humans  symmetrically  at  different   scales   until   they   become   “archaeological   things”,   with   the   aim   of   encapsulating  different   opinions   and   perspectives   on   “things”   which   are   basically   the   essential   data   of  archaeology.   Proposals   for   20   minute   papers   should   be   sent   by   email  to  [email protected].   Further   information   is   available   at  http://tagturkey2014.wordpress.com.
